AZIMUTH CIRCLE TOKIMEC, I.D. 246MM
The Azimuth Circle is mounted on the repeater compass. By means of a prism and reflection mirror, sunlight is projected in the form of a line on to the compass card through a slit, thus making it possible to observe the sun.
